Hi I have just been to my LFS as I am just looking at what fish I can get when my cycle is complete,
He mentioned redneck severums and I do like them tbh but they do look quite big.
my tank is 40g and he says they will be ok in that size so I thought i would double check with you guys to see what you think

A 40g could be done but an adult would be much better suited for a 4ft 55g minimum.

As a juvenile you could if you kept up with water changes.

As it grows though I would look towards that 55 or a 75

Redneck severum :D all I can think of is a severum that listens to country music and drives a tractor. That's my kind of severum. They are probably referring to a Rotkiel severum or an orange shoulder severum.

I would not recommend a 40 breeder length wise they would fit but they are a very all fish as well. Stick a white paper plate up to your tank and that is how an adult severum would look in there.

40 breeder is a great size tnak one of my favorites because of the length. If you want a cichlid but one with color and not overly aggressive look at at a group of rainbow cichlids.

Electric Blue Acara, firemouths, convicts, Rams would all work nicely obviously not all together.

Severum are on the low end of the aggression level for cichlids so makes them a great addition to community tanks. With any type of fish you can get one on the more aggressive side but that isn't typical. They would do just fine with barbs and red tails shark. Also would be fine with larger tetras like diamonds, lemons, columbains. Again if it is in the 40b you will have to upgrade in a year or so.
 
My experience with severums ... They get large fairly quick so a big tank is in order, they may not do well in groups once they start to mature but they do very well by themselves with other fish.
I had them with angels without any issues, very peaceful but very fast getting to the food and very fast to grow.
